"The best day of your life hasn't happened yet, and you haven't met everyone that will love you."

Actor, writer and hopeless romantic Rebecca Humphries had often been called crazy by her boyfriend. But when paparazzi caught him kissing his Strictly Come Dancing partner, she realised the only crazy thing was believing she didn't deserve more.

A flood of support poured in on social media, but amongst the well-wishes was a simple question with an infinitely complex answer: 'If he was so bad, why did you stay?'

Empowering, unflinching and full of humour, this book takes that question and owns it. Using her relationship history and experiences since the scandal during Strictly, Rebecca explores why good girls are drawn to darkness, whether pop culture glamourises toxicity, when a relationship 'rough patch' becomes the start of a destructive cycle, if women are conditioned for co-dependency, and - ultimately - how to reframe disaster into something magical.
